The Basics of Forex Trading
Forex, short for foreign exchange, is the global marketplace where currencies are traded. It’s a massive market, with over $6 trillion traded daily, making it the largest and most liquid market in the world. When you learn forex, you’re not just learning about trading; you’re learning about global economics, politics, and even psychology. Every trade you make reflects the ebb and flow of international relations and economic health.
Understanding the Market
The Forex market operates 24 hours a day, five days a week, and it never sleeps. This means you can trade whenever you want, which is a huge advantage of online Forex. You don’t have to be tied to a specific time or place. You can trade from your laptop on the beach or your smartphone during your morning commute. The market is always open, and that’s a freedom you won’t find in many other markets.

Risk Management
Risk management is a critical part of Forex trading. It’s not just about making profits; it’s about protecting your capital. This means setting stop-loss orders to limit your losses and taking profits when the time is right. It’s also about diversifying your trades to spread the risk. Remember, the goal is to stay in the game, not to make a quick buck and then exit.

Staying Informed
The Forex market is influenced by a multitude of factors, from economic data releases to geopolitical events. Staying informed is crucial to making smart trades. This means following the news, understanding economic indicators, and keeping an eye on global events. The more you know, the better your decisions will be.
